Amos Isah, the founder of the Prophetic Victory Voice of Fire Ministry in Gwagwaada, Abuja, is now in detention over allegations involving a 14-year-old girl.

He was arrested last week by the Federal Criminal Investigation Department (FCID).

His arrest has stunned the community, where Isah was widely known for his passionate preaching and strong moral teachings.

The church, located behind Noble Noel Academy and opposite the Gwagwalada Market, had attracted a sizable following.

Isah’s social media often featured posts promoting spiritual growth and righteous living.

His last appearance at the church was on Wednesday, June 18, 2025. A service held the following day took place in his absence.

According to reports, Isah allegedly misused his position to act inappropriately toward the minor.

FCID officials have confirmed the nature of the allegations, although direct communication with Isah has not been possible.

Some sources suggest that efforts may be underway behind the scenes to reduce public attention on the case.

Due to the sensitivity of the matter and Isah’s influence in the community, investigators are reportedly proceeding with caution.
